AlumierMD Alumience A.G.E.® is an advanced daily serum designed to protect skin from the visible signs of aging caused by environmental stressors and glycation. This lightweight antioxidant treatment combines a powerful blend of vitamin C, vitamin E, glutathione, and an exclusive encapsulated resveratrol to neutralize free radicals and reduce oxidative stress. Arginine, carnosine, and specialized botanical extracts help combat glycation—a process that weakens collagen and elastin—while supporting firmness, elasticity, and resilience. With continued use, skin looks smoother, brighter, and more youthful, with reduced appearance of fine lines and environmental damage.

Carnosine, Silymarin and Vitamin E: A combination of a naturally occurring dipeptide with 2 antioxidants that together decrease the formation of A.G.E.s.

Acetyl Tyrosine, Proline, ATP: An amino acid-rich complex with an energy source that combats the look of glycated skin.

Arginine: An amino acid that has a dual-action, which prevents glycation and reduces A.G.E.s.

Exo-P(Alteromonas Ferment Extract): A sustainable purified polysaccharide from a unique sustainable ecosystem in the French Polynesia, Exo-P forms a biomimetic shield on the surface of the skin to protect against pollution and smog. Exo-P purifies dull and devitalized skin and prevents premature aging.

Tocopherol Acetate (Vitamin E): A highly moisturizing and fat-soluble vitamin that acts as an antioxidant, which strengthens the effect of vitamin C.

Tetrahexyldecyl Ascorbate (Vitamin C): A stable oil-soluble form of vitamin C that is a powerful antioxidant that protects cells from free radical damage caused by the sun and pollution. Vitamin C is essential for collagen synthesis, which helps re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. It also brightens and evens out skin tone.

How should I use Alumience A.G.E. with retinoids or chemical exfoliants?
Yes, you can use Alumier Alumience A.G.E. with retinoids or acids, but you should layer and time them to minimize irritation. Because Alumience A.G.E. is an antioxidant serum designed to protect against environmental damage, apply it after cleansing and before heavier creams. If you use active retinoids or strong chemical exfoliants, either alternate nights or apply the antioxidant serum in the morning and the retinoid at night to reduce overlap of potentially irritating actives. Always follow with a moisturizer if needed and apply broad spectrum sunscreen in the morning since antioxidants complement but do not replace sun protection. If you experience sensitivity, reduce frequency, perform a patch test and consult your skincare professional for a tailored regimen.
